Minnesota Framing Subcontractor Rate Ranges by Region (2026)

Minnesota's construction labor market is not monolithic. The Twin Cities metro area—encompassing Minneapolis, St. Paul, Bloomington, and the surrounding suburban ring—operates at a fundamentally different cost structure than Duluth, Rochester, or rural communities in the western and northern counties. Cost of living, union density, and project volume all drive these differences.

Twin Cities Metro: Minneapolis, St. Paul, Bloomington

In the seven-county metro, framing subcontractors typically charge $45–$65 per hour all-in for skilled carpenters. This rate includes base wage, workers' compensation (which for framing in Minnesota runs 18–28% of payroll depending on experience modification rate), general liability, payroll taxes, and contractor overhead. On private commercial work—office buildings, retail, multifamily—you'll see rates cluster near $50–$58 per hour for experienced framers capable of reading complex plans, managing material waste, and coordinating with MEP trades.

Union shops affiliated with the North Central States Regional Council of Carpenters often quote higher: $58–$65 per hour, reflecting collectively bargained wages and robust fringe benefit packages. Non-union shops remain competitive by running leaner crews, faster schedules, and tighter material management, but the quality and safety record of your chosen sub matters as much as the hourly rate.

When bidding large-format projects—warehouses, big-box retail, or tilt-up structures—framers may offer per-square-foot pricing instead of hourly. Expect $7–$16 per square foot for rough framing, with the range driven by complexity: simple post-and-beam garages fall at the low end, while multi-story wood-frame multifamily with complex floor plans and engineered lumber push toward the top. Material costs in 2026 hover around $8–$12 per board foot, fluctuating with lumber futures and supply chain conditions. Labor typically represents 55–65% of total framing cost on commercial work, so your sub's crew productivity and hourly rate have outsized impact.

Greater Minnesota: Rochester, Duluth, St. Cloud

Rochester, Minnesota's third-largest city, sees framing rates in the $40–$52 per hour range. The Mayo Clinic's ongoing expansion and related commercial development sustain demand, but lower cost of living and reduced union density keep rates below the Twin Cities. Duluth and the Iron Range markets trend even lower—$38–$48 per hour—due to smaller project pipelines, lower wage floors, and a larger pool of non-union subs willing to travel for work.

St. Cloud, serving central Minnesota, sits in the middle: $42–$50 per hour is typical for experienced framing crews. On public work subject to prevailing wage (discussed below), these rates jump significantly, often matching or exceeding Twin Cities private-market rates.

Rural and Seasonal Rate Adjustments

Rural Minnesota—communities outside the major metros—experiences framing rates 12–18% below the Twin Cities average. Expect $35–$45 per hour in counties like Otter Tail, Kandiyohi, or Stearns. Lower overhead, smaller crew sizes, and reduced regulatory enforcement (though still subject to OSHA and state building codes) enable these subs to bid competitively. However, mobilization costs can offset savings if your project is more than 90 minutes from the sub's home base; always clarify whether quoted rates include travel time and per diem.

Seasonality matters in Minnesota. Winter conditions—November through March—impose significant productivity losses and safety challenges. Framers working in sub-zero temperatures with snow cover, frozen ground, and short daylight hours typically add 8–15% winter premiums. Enclosures, temporary heat, and overtime to meet schedules during shorter work windows all drive up costs. If you're bidding a project with a winter construction schedule, explicitly ask subs whether their rate accounts for seasonal conditions or if they'll issue a change order when temperatures drop.

Prevailing Wage & Public Work Impact on Minnesota Rates

Prevailing wage laws radically alter subcontractor pricing on public projects. Minnesota Statutes Chapter 177 requires that workers on state-funded construction projects—schools, municipal buildings, state highways, public housing—be paid wages and fringes at or above the prevailing rate for their trade and county. The Minnesota Department of Labor and Industry (DOLI) publishes county-specific prevailing wage schedules updated annually, and these rates often exceed private-market wages by 25–35%.

When Prevailing Wage Applies (Schools, State-Funded Projects)

Any project receiving state appropriations, bonding, or local tax levy funds above statutory thresholds triggers prevailing wage. This includes K-12 schools, community colleges, public libraries, government office buildings, and infrastructure. Federal projects (post offices, VA facilities, Corps of Engineers work) fall under Davis-Bacon prevailing wage, which operates similarly but uses U.S. Department of Labor wage determinations.

For framing and rough carpentry, Minnesota prevailing wage rates in 2026 typically range from $58–$72 per hour base wage, plus fringes (health, pension, training) that add another $15–$25 per hour. Total package rates can exceed $85–$95 per hour in the metro, compared to $50–$58 for identical work on private projects. Subs must also maintain certified payroll records, submit weekly compliance reports, and face penalties for underpayment—administrative burdens that add to overhead.

How Prevailing Wage Inflates Sub Costs vs. Private Work

Consider a 40,000-square-foot high school addition in Hennepin County. On private work, a framing sub might bid $320,000 (roughly $8 per square foot), assuming 6,400 labor hours at $50/hour all-in. On the same scope under prevailing wage, that sub must pay carpenters $68/hour base plus $22/hour fringe—total $90/hour package. Even if the sub absorbs some fringes into overhead or benefits they already provide, the effective loaded rate jumps to $72–$78/hour. The same 6,400 hours now costs $460,800–$499,200, a 44–56% increase.

Many subs, particularly smaller outfits unfamiliar with prevailing wage compliance, will underbid public work by using their private-market rates. This creates a ticking time bomb: either they eat the loss, cut corners (risking DOLI audit and penalties), or file claims against the GC. As the general contractor or construction manager, you must catch these discrepancies during bid leveling.

Spot-Checking Sub Rates Against Prevailing Wage Schedules

Download the current DOLI prevailing wage schedule for your project county and trade. Compare the base hourly rate and fringe total to the implied hourly rate in each sub's bid. Divide their lump-sum price by estimated labor hours (use RSMeans or your own historical data for hours per square foot). If a framing sub bids $350,000 on a prevailing-wage project where the schedule mandates $90/hour and you estimate 6,000 hours, their implied rate is $58/hour—a $32/hour shortfall that signals either a scope miss, unsustainable pricing, or ignorance of prevailing wage.

How to Use Bid Leveling to Spot Rate Anomalies

Bid leveling is the process of comparing subcontractor proposals side-by-side to identify scope gaps, pricing outliers, and qualification differences. Done well, it prevents costly surprises during buyout. Done poorly—or skipped in the rush to submit—it leads to budget overruns, change orders, and eroded margins.

Side-by-Side Sub Bid Comparison: Flagging Outlier Pricing

When you receive five framing bids ranging from $165,000 to $210,000 for identical scope, the instinct is to take the lowest number and move on. Resist that urge. The low bidder may have excluded sheathing, omitted blocking for MEP hangers, or misread the floor plan square footage. The high bidder might include premium engineered lumber, waste factors for complex geometries, or a winter-work premium others ignored.

Create a bid leveling matrix in Excel or your estimating platform. Columns: sub name, total price, unit price ($/SF or $/LF), included scope items (framing, sheathing, blocking, hardware, cleanup), exclusions, qualifications, and normalized metrics. Rows: each sub. Calculate the mean and standard deviation of total prices. Any bid more than one standard deviation from the mean deserves scrutiny.

Normalizing Bids Across Trade-Specific Metrics

Framing subs quote in different formats: lump sum, cost per square foot, cost per linear foot of wall, or time-and-materials with a not-to-exceed cap. Normalize everything to a common unit—dollars per square foot of building area is typical for rough framing—so you can compare rates across subs and projects.

Minnesota Framing Rate Table: 2026 Labor & Material Benchmarks

The following table synthesizes current market data, AGC Minnesota survey insights, and 2026 wage trends to provide region-specific framing subcontractor rates. Use these as starting points for your estimates, adjusting for project complexity, schedule, and specific sub qualifications.

Detailed Rate Table by Sub Type and Region

Region Work Type Labor Rate ($/hr, all-in) Typical $/SF Range Notes
Twin Cities Metro Private Commercial $50–$58 $7.00–$10.00 Non-union, experienced crews
Twin Cities Metro Private Commercial (Union) $58–$65 $8.50–$12.00 Union-affiliated, higher fringes
Twin Cities Metro Public/Prevailing Wage $72–$90 $11.00–$16.00 Includes base + fringes per DOLI schedule
Rochester Private Commercial $40–$52 $6.50–$9.50 Lower COL, high demand from Mayo projects
Duluth Private Commercial $38–$48 $6.00–$8.50 Smaller market, willing to travel
St. Cloud Private Commercial $42–$50 $6.50–$9.00 Central MN, moderate demand
Rural Minnesota Private Commercial $35–$45 $5.50–$8.00 Add mobilization if >90 min travel
Statewide Winter Premium +8–15% +$0.50–$1.50/SF Nov–Mar, enclosures/heat/short days

Material Cost Trends and Labor/Material Split

Lumber and engineered wood products remain volatile in 2026. Dimensional framing lumber (2x4, 2x6, 2x10) averages $8–$12 per board foot depending on species, grade, and supply. Southern Yellow Pine and SPF (Spruce-Pine-Fir) dominate the Minnesota market. Engineered lumber—LVL beams, I-joists, rim board—costs 20–40% more per linear foot but reduces labor and waste on complex spans.

OSB sheathing runs $18–$28 per sheet (4x8, 7/16" or 1/2"), up from $12–$18 in 2023 but stabilized from the 2021–22 spike. Plywood sheathing costs 15–25% more than OSB but offers better moisture resistance and fastener holding.

On a typical commercial framing package, expect labor to account for 55–65% of total cost, materials 35–45%. If a sub's bid shows labor at 70%+, they may be inflating hourly rates to cover inefficiency or risk. Conversely, if material dominates, the sub might be padding material costs or using retail pricing instead of contractor discounts.

Year-over-Year Changes from 2025

Minnesota framing rates in 2026 are up 3–6% from 2025, driven by wage pressure, insurance cost increases, and persistent labor shortages. AGC Minnesota's 2026 Construction Outlook survey indicates contractors are less optimistic than in 2025, citing reduced project pipelines and rising input costs. However, the tight labor market—construction unemployment in Minnesota remains near historic lows—keeps upward pressure on wages.

Material costs have stabilized after the extreme volatility of 2021–2023, but lumber futures remain sensitive to housing starts, tariffs, and supply chain disruptions. Budget a 5–8% material cost escalation contingency for projects breaking ground more than six months out.
